Henley Stoves is Ireland's leading supplier of stoves, boilers, inserts, and fireplaces & Electric Fires. Founded in 1985 in County Kerry, Henley now has distribution centres in Tralee, Dublin, and Cambridge UK.

I purchased a Henley Lisbon 900 stove…
I purchased a Henley Lisbon 900 stove for over €2,100 in November 2020 from a stove supplier in Midleton and paid another €1000 to have it installed.
When lit, smoke leaks through the fire rope around the edges of the glass door. We have contacted Henley Stoves in Kerry numerous times about this issue as the stove has a 5 year warranty. (This warranty is also detailed on the Henley Stoves website). Their sales rep agreed there was an issue and agreed to come to inspect the stove, which never happened. After further calls over 1/2 a year, he agreed to send out a replacement wider fire rope. Needless to say, this hasn’t happened either. We have also contacted the stove manufacturer, Thermofoc, in Portugal. Their only email response was to contact Henley Stoves in Kerry.
I so regret installing this particular stove and advise anyone thinking of purchasing a Henley Stove to give them a wide berth! Buyer beware!

Henley Stoves: A Disastrous Investment
I made what I thought was a dream purchase, a HETAS compliant stove from Henley Stoves, but my experience has been nothing short of a nightmare. Two years ago, I was captivated by the allure of a beautiful stove that promised both functionality and aesthetic appeal. However, the reality of my investment has been a far cry from my initial excitement.
Let's start with the positives - the stove looked stunning. With its elegant curves, an expansive window to watch the fire dance, and the promise of ample heat, I had high hopes for it. It was meant to be the focal point of my home, providing warmth and ambiance for years to come.
However, the trouble began before I could even enjoy its radiant glow. Installing the stove was a bureaucratic nightmare, taking over six months due to the complications of finding a certified installer during lockdowns. By the time I could finally bask in its warmth, winter 2021/2022 had arrived.
In autumn 2022, I did what any responsible stove owner would do and had it serviced by a certified installer. That's when the bombshell dropped - the inside boards of the stove were all warped and cracked. My installer informed me that while they might survive another season, it was time to consider replacing them. Naturally, I turned to Henley Stoves for support, thinking that a quality product from a reputable company would be backed by a reasonable warranty.
To my dismay, Henley Stoves washed their hands of the issue. According to their response, the "bricks" were not covered by the warranty. This came as a complete shock to me since the warranty I received did not specify any such exclusions. What's worse, these so-called "bricks" aren't even bricks! They appear to be some sort of fireproof board resembling MDF, which apparently costs a small fortune to replace. If they were indeed bricks, they shouldn't crack so easily in the first place.
My disappointment in Henley Stoves knows no bounds. I had placed my faith in them when I made my purchase, believing I was investing in a top-tier product. Now, I find myself shelling out 56 euros plus delivery every two years just to keep the stove running, thanks to the necessity of replacing these shoddy "bricks." This is neither practical nor feasible.
Henley Stoves' unclear and ever-changing warranty policies are a red flag for any potential buyers. I strongly advise against purchasing any products from them. Consider your options carefully before falling into the same trap I did. Don't let their alluring promises lead you astray; you've been warned.
[UPDATE: In a desperate bid to salvage my investment, I had to purchase a few grog bricks for under 3 quid each. With some elbow grease and an angle grinder, I managed to cut them to shape, and surprisingly, they're working like a charm. This "DIY solution" should never have been necessary with a reputable product, and it further highlights the inadequacies of Henley Stoves' offering.]
